#d397bb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d397bb is composed of 82.7% red, 59.2% green and 73.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 28.4% magenta, 11.4% yellow and 17.3% black. It has a hue angle of 324 degrees, a saturation of 40.5% and a lightness of 71%. #d397bb color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#a72f77.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

#d397bb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d397bb has RGB values of R:211, G:151, B:187 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.28, Y:0.11,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 13866939.
